Hi,

We're now producing our database in PGSQL, switching from M$ SQL Server,
and I think that pgAdmin is a fantastic tool.

The following refer to 1.6.1 on Win32.

I have two minor issues:

(1) In the SQL Editor tool, File and Favourites are both configured to
use 'F' as an access key.  This is really, really irritating because
Alt+F doesn't work.  Please set it to Fav&ourites instead.
(2) When I open Help, it seems to be set as a child window or
something.  This really annoying, because when I click on the main
pgAdmin window, I have to move the help one out of the way first.

...and on another note, as a new user I find the distinction betwixt
Procedures and Functions slightly arbitrary.  I realise that it mirrors
Enterprise Manager and suchlike, but in PGSQL they're all called functions.

I'm sure they're easy fixes, but that would make life so much the
better, particularly whilst I try and rid my mind of all the perversions
of T-SQL!

Thanks, fixed in SVN trunk. I cannot easily fix it in the 1.6 branch 
without breaking the translations unfortunately.

> (2) When I open Help, it seems to be set as a child window or
> something.  This really annoying, because when I click on the main
> pgAdmin window, I have to move the help one out of the way first.

Unfortunately that's down to the wxWidgets library we use. I agree it 
can be annoying, but there's not much that can be done about it without 
considerable effort to reimplement the help system.

> ...and on another note, as a new user I find the distinction betwixt
> Procedures and Functions slightly arbitrary.  I realise that it mirrors
> Enterprise Manager and suchlike, but in PGSQL they're all called functions.

That's an ongoing debate :-). They're called procedures because that's 
what they are in EnterpriseDB where they first appeared.I'm beginning to 
think we should just make that a per-server behavioural change.
